Transaction fa2034bc31b31063b528c330cc284ed3b3f16dd8e3a7a1a28d15965fcefc05c2
2 Input
2 Outputs
- fa2034bc31b31063b528c330cc284ed3b3f16dd8e3a7a1a28d15965fcefc05c2:0
- fa2034bc31b31063b528c330cc284ed3b3f16dd8e3a7a1a28d15965fcefc05c2:1
value 31446
address 13v1Xeh4SD6qLdxxHnepKCHhebbHwJAnWi
value 1026995
address 123wudRSarSqk1rGVAiKDYsCJKFTEyt51K